The v8.30 patch for Fortnite, containing the highly awaited respawn feature in the form of the Reboot Van, is due out on April 10th.

The size of the patch, however, is way bigger than usual. It ranges from the still quite large 1.14GB to the massive 7.7GB. Platforms and their patch sizes are listed below:

  • PC: 6.93GB
  • Mac: 7.7GB
  • PlayStation 4: 3.9GB
  • Xbox: 4.06GB
  • Switch: 3.93GB
  • iOS: 1.14 – 1.76GB
  • Android: 1.56 – 2.98GB

Epic say that if your mobile device has less than 6gb of space, you’ll need to re-download Fortnite entirely.

Fans are hoping that the patch will revert the changes that were previously added in the v7.40 patch before being removed in the v8.20 patch.

The v7.40 patch for Fortnite added Pop-up Cup settings to the game, but these settings were reverted with the v8.20 patch.

The changes in the v7.40 patch were as follows:

  • 50 Health (or Shield) based on your health when elimination occurs.
  • 50/50/50 materials dropped on elimination.
  • 500/500/500 cap on materials.
  • Harvest rate increased by 40%

Epic said that the reason they removed the changes in the v8.20 patch was because of ‘an unhealthy level of aggressive play’. Despite this, fans still seem to be eager to get the changes back, especially as the majority of replies to every single Fortnite tweet are just “revert”.

Downtime for the patch begins tomorrow at 5am ET/10am BST.
